Lesley Batchelor CBECEO, Export Boot Camps; former Director General of the Institute of Export and International TradeLesley Batchelor CBE is a leading champion of UK exporters, renowned for transforming the international performance of hundreds of businesses. With her deep expertise in global strategy, she works across industry and government, advising MakeUK and numerous trade associations on building globally sustainable businesses. Her blue-chip background spans Ciba-Geigy Pharmaceuticals, Coca-Cola Europe, and Fujitsu, giving her an exceptional understanding of manufacturing, compliance, FTAs, and Rules of Origin in market expansion and supply chains. An original thinker, Lesley is known for tackling barriers to trade with innovation and practical insight. Now Chair of The Paddy Ashdown Policy Research Forum, she previously spent 12 years as Director General of the Institute of Export & Int. Trade where she advanced professionalism, training, and support for businesses through the Brexit transition. She also advised government departments, panels and Select Committees on trade, manufacturing, and SME support, and contributed to ICC/WTO MSME negotiations and the WTO Alliance for Trade & Investment. Awarded an OBE in 2014 and promoted to CBE in King Charles III’s New Year Honours for services to International Trade, Lesley is also active in the City of London as a Court Assistant of the Worshipful Company of World Traders and a Freeman of the City since 2008.
